Leveling the Odds: Google Ads Updates Policy on Gambling and Games for a Safer Online Experience

Google Ads, the dominant force in online advertising, has recently implemented updates to its policies regarding gambling and games. These changes, aimed at enhancing user safety and compliance, have significant implications for advertisers operating in the gambling and gaming industries.
In a move to ensure responsible advertising practices, Google has tightened its regulations surrounding the promotion of gambling-related content across its advertising platforms. The updated policy seeks to strike a balance between allowing legitimate gambling businesses to advertise while protecting vulnerable users, particularly minors and individuals with gambling addiction issues.

Key aspects of the updated policy include

Age Restrictions

Google now requires advertisers promoting gambling-related content to comply with applicable laws and regulations, including those related to age restrictions. Advertisements for gambling products or services must not target individuals under the legal gambling age in their respective jurisdictions.

Geographical Restrictions

Advertisers must adhere to regional regulations governing online gambling. Google will only allow ads for gambling-related content from licensed operators in certain countries or regions where online gambling is legal and regulated.

Responsible Gambling Messaging

Advertisers are required to include responsible gambling messaging in their ads, such as information on how to seek help for problem gambling or resources for responsible gambling practices. This messaging aims to promote awareness and support for individuals who may be struggling with gambling addiction.

Prohibited Content

Certain types of gambling-related content remain prohibited on Google Ads, including ads promoting illegal gambling activities, deceptive gambling practices, or gambling products targeted at minors.
The updated policy reflects Google’s ongoing commitment to promoting a safe and transparent advertising environment across its platforms. By implementing stricter guidelines for gambling-related ads, Google aims to protect users from potentially harmful or exploitative content while supporting responsible gambling practices within the industry.
For advertisers operating in the gambling and gaming sectors, compliance with Google’s updated policies is crucial to ensure continued access to the platform’s vast audience and advertising capabilities. Failure to adhere to these policies may result in ads being disapproved or accounts being suspended, leading to potential revenue losses and reputational damage.
